    I'm in Staten Island and we didnt hit any of the long Island venues mostly because of traffic reasons but we LOVEDDDDD westmount country club in Jersey...the cocktail room was more of a lounge feel with an awesome bar (didn't feel like a hall)...i saw your previous posts about Addison Park and Palace...I heard some friends not like Palace beacuse of the way they were treated. We looked at Addison too really liked it but I wasn't crazy about the rooms being across from each other. It's going to be really hard to find a place in June for 150...We originally wanted November but now that is even considered "in season" and the prices were crazy...after calling the halls to get quotes for Feb it was wayyyy cheaper (ex. Naninnas in the Park wanted 310 for Nov and 150 for Feb)

    Chateau Briand is very nice. Some venues you may want to look into out in Long Island are Crest Hollow Country Club, Jericho Terrace, The Inn at New Hyde Park, Sand Castle. A friend of mine just booked her wedding at Sand Castle and their rates were very reasonable for a Saturday wedding. If you live in Brooklyn, you may want to look at the Vanderbilt in Staten Island (near the Verrazano Bridge). We just recently shot a wedding there. The wedding ceremony was outside and absolutely breathtaking and the hall is very nice too.
